all of them
A totality or entirety; primarily denotes 'all' or 'the whole' of a set (people, things, groups, time, or circumstances), often serving to indicate inclusiveness or completeness in statements. In varied contexts, it can function to intensify, to emphasize comprehensiveness, or to refer to the entirety of a subset. Used both absolutely and in construct to mean 'all of,' 'every,' 'any,' or 'whole.'

to the entirety of them
| Morphological Notes | Preposition לְ + masculine singular construct noun כֹּל + 3rd person masculine plural pronominal suffix; literally "to the whole of them." |
| Rendering Rationale | The noun כֹּל denotes totality or completeness, and in construct with the 3rd masculine plural suffix it means "the whole of them." The prefixed לְ adds the sense "to/for," yielding "to the entirety of them," preserving both root meaning and morphology. |
